I am using Reckon Premier 2016 and when I email the payslips through Outlook 2016, people who open them with an apple device find the PDF file changed to a win.dat file that they can't open.
When I resend from my sent file they go through correctly.
I am sending in plain text as using any other text causes the same problem for windows users
